When a team works across different cities and time zones, human error is no longer the responsibility of a single person. It becomes a symptom of design: information scattered across emails, unstructured chats, confusing document versions, lack of shared criteria, and manual tasks that depend on memory. An intranet with chat for distributed teams can reduce those errors if it is conceived as an operating system for work, not as a simple bulletin board. The key is to give it business logic, validations and automation; in other words, to build custom software instead of installing a generic tool.
The first source of mistakes in distributed teams is loss of context. An operator writes an incident; a colleague reads it hours later without knowing the customer, the priority or the applicable regulation. Another person uses an outdated template. Another updates a spreadsheet that nobody consults. The intranet must centralize that information and require complete data before the process can move forward. Mandatory fields, validation rules, alerts and approval workflows turn error into an exception, not the routine. In addition, every action is recorded, so any deviation can be located and corrected in time.
The chat integrated into the intranet gains value when it is linked to processes. Instead of discussing in private messages, teams resolve a request within a file; each comment is associated with a task, a customer and a version of the document. The system can escalate if there is no response, remind about deadlines and prevent a decision from remaining in the air. This traceability reduces failures caused by poor communication, misunderstandings and rework. To achieve this, buying a standard solution is not enough: it is necessary to customize the data model, flow states and notifications.
It is worth insisting on the difference between a messaging channel and an operational intranet. A loose chat can even increase errors if it generates noise and fragmentation. The difference lies in the data model: a request must have a status, owner, priority, due date and relationship with other documents. When the conversation is part of the file, the chat becomes institutional memory. For example, in a purchase request, the intranet can validate the cost centre, consult the supplier catalogue, request the corresponding approval and notify the requester. If a piece of data is missing, the system does not allow the request to advance. This prevents an incorrect purchase or a charge in the wrong department.
Data quality is another key front. Employees make fewer mistakes when the tool shows them the right data at the moment of acting. An intranet with artificial intelligence can suggest responses, classify tickets, detect inconsistencies or propose the next step. This support layer does not replace human judgement, but it reduces cognitive load and rushed decisions. AI agents are especially useful in distributed teams because they respond from the corporate knowledge base, respect permissions and allow a less experienced person to act as if an expert were beside them. If they are also connected to systems of record, they can prepare drafts, check data and warn when an operation seems out of range.
For that intelligence to work properly, technical deployment matters as much as functional design. A cloud architecture also facilitates secure access from different regions and avoids investing in hardware that quickly becomes obsolete.
Cybersecurity is not an add-on. A distributed intranet handles personal data, intellectual property, contracts and internal conversations. It is necessary to define roles, permissions by country or department, retention policies, encryption at rest and in transit, as well as backups. When a company works with sensitive data, team confidence depends on the tool being secure and auditable. Well-controlled access not only protects information, but also prevents serious errors caused by badly configured permissions or accidental data exposure.
Another key component is measurement. Reducing human error requires seeing where it happens. With BI/Power BI tools, it is possible to monitor the percentage of requests with incomplete data, average resolution time, transfers between areas or the rate of corrected tasks. These indicators help prioritize actions and demonstrate return on investment. An updated dashboard also helps teams understand the real impact of their work and improve decision-making. In distributed environments, unified visibility is the foundation of continuous improvement because no one can rely on informal observations to know whether the process works.
Reducing human error also involves managing adoption. If the tool is slow or adds unnecessary steps, teams will look for shortcuts and return to emails and loose spreadsheets. Therefore, the user experience must be very simple: few clicks, autocomplete, predefined answers, mobile accessibility and natural language search. An intranet designed with usability criteria reduces friction and allows employees to follow the formal process without feeling watched. Technology must be a silent ally, not another obstacle. Moreover, short, contextual training should be offered at the moment of use.
